What were the average and median salaries for a Pharmacy Clinical Lead listed in the 2024 Ontario Government Sunshine List?

The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List shows that the average and median salaries for a Pharmacy Clinical Lead are $139,919.74 and $137,188.96, respectively.

What is the highest salary for a Pharmacy Clinical Lead in a public organization in Ontario?

In 2024, Lawrence Bertoldo, holding the position of Pharmacy Clinical Lead at the Thunder Bay Regional Health Sciences Centre received the highest salary of $162,938.66 among similar positions in Ontario public organizations.

What are the top 5 public organizations in Ontario that offer the highest salaries for Pharmacy Clinical Lead?

In the year 2024, the highest-paying organizations for Pharmacy Clinical Lead and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Thunder Bay Regional Health Sciences Centre with an average pay of $151,578.43; Kingston Health Sciences Centre with an average pay of $148,481.72; Chatham-Kent Health Alliance with an average pay of $141,213.84; Unity Health Toronto with an average pay of $135,538.53; and Grand River Hospital Corporation with an average pay of $119,452.96.

A total of 5 organizations had employees who held comparable positions as mentioned in the Ontario Sunshine list.
